For-løkke i PHP
Løkken for giver mulighed for at gentage
en bestemt kode et angivet antal gange.
Her er dens syntaks:
Her er dens syntaks:
<?php
for ( startkommandoer; stopbetingelse; kommandoer efter gennemløb ) {
løkkens krop
}
?>
Startkommandoer - er det, der udføres før løkken starter. De udføres kun én gang. Normalt placeres startværdier for tællere der. Stopbetingelse - er betingelsen for, at løkken kører, så længe den er sand. Kommandoer efter gennemløb - er kommandoer, der udføres hver gang efter et gennemløb af løkken. Normalt forøges tællere der.
Lad os ved hjælp af løkken for udskrive
tallene fra 1 til 9 i rækkefølge:
<?php
for ($i = 1; $i <= 9; $i++) {
echo $i;
}
?>
Lad os nu forøge tælleren ikke
med 1, men med 2:
<?php
for ($i = 1; $i <= 9; $i += 2) {
echo $i;
}
?>
Man kan lave et nedtællingsforløb:
<?php
for ($i = 10; $i > 0; $i--) {
echo $i;
}
?>
Brug løkken for til at vise tallene fra 1 til 100 på skærmen.
Brug løkken for til at vise tallene fra 11 til 33 på skærmen.
Brug løkken for til at vise de lige tal i intervallet fra 0 til 100 på skærmen.
Brug løkken for til at vise de ulige tal i intervallet fra 1 til 99 på skærmen.
Brug løkken for til at vise tallene fra 100 til 0 på skærmen.